Description: CHILDCARE NETWORK #92B is a Five Star Center License in CHARLOTTE NC, with a maximum capacity of 27 children. This child care center helps with children in the age range of 0 through 12. The provider also participates in a subsidized child care program.

2023-01-24 | Violation | 1065 | .1102(f) |
Child care providers scheduled to work in the infant room, did not complete ITS-SIDS training within two months of employment or did not complete the training every three years. Child care administrators did not complete the ITS-SIDS training within 90 days of employment and every three years thereafter. The infant room teacher's ITS-SIDS training expired December 12, 2022. | |||
2023-01-24 | Violation | 1831 | .01102 (f) |
At least one child care provider, who has completed ITS-SIDS training was not present in the infant room, while children were in care. The teacher working in the infant room did not have current ITS-SIDS training. | |||

2021-09-14 | Violation | 892 | .0606(b) |
The center's safe sleep policy was not posted in a prominent place in the infant room where parents and caregivers were able to view daily. In space #2, the safe sleep policy was not posted. | |||
2021-09-14 | Violation | 716 | .0605(j) |
All stationary equipment, more than 18 inches high, was not installed over protective surfacing. The mulch in the fall zone for the swings measured at two inches, four inches and one inch in depth instead of the required six inches. | |||
2021-09-14 | Violation | 887 | .0606(g) |
Caregivers did not document compliance with visually checking on sleeping infants aged 12 months or younger and/or the documents were not maintained for a minimum of one month. In space #2, documentation for visually checking on one infant less than 12 months was not on file for September 13, 2021 and September 14, 2021. | |||
